Honoka Hayashi (林 穂之香, Hayashi Honoka, born 19 May 1998) is a Japanese profess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Women's Super League club West Ham United and the Japan national team. A full international since 2019, she represented Japan at the 2023 FIFA World Cup and the 2020 Olympics.

  6. 8 de sept. de 2022 · 8th September 2022. West Ham United Women are delighted to announce the signing of Japanese international Honoka Hayashi, subject to FA approval. The 24-year-old attacking midfielder has joined the Hammers on a two-year-contract for an undisclosed fee from Swedish Damallsvenskan side AIK Fotboll.
